Transaction fbd79cff528990862988bc37e4d33b2cab9188df0300914a557363042e4e64e2

1 Input
2 Outputs
  • fbd79cff528990862988bc37e4d33b2cab9188df0300914a557363042e4e64e2:0
  • value  998644
    address  17FZszyeGmoAAb2XNkajoxrQfTnhFV9oTy
  • fbd79cff528990862988bc37e4d33b2cab9188df0300914a557363042e4e64e2:1
  • value  19100000
    address  1Afb7t4fwXLS6LWmQAawUefgZiTc3BSzMJ